WASHINGTON (AP) - Richard A. Clarke, the former White House counterterrorism coordinator, accuses the Bush administration of failing to recognize the al-Qaida threat before the Sept. 11, 2001,

'' He said he wrote to National Security Adviser Condoleezza Rice on Jan. 24, 2001, asking ``urgently'' for a Cabinet-level meeting ``to deal with the impending al-Qaida attack.''
